Although reactions between (-)ephedrine E2-(S)-methylamino-l-(R)-phenylpropan-l-017 and RPOC12 (R = Cl, alkyl, aryl, alkoxy, aryloxy) can in principle afford pairs of 1,3,2-oxazaphospholanes eyimeric at phosphorus, most reports describe only one product from highly stereoselective reactions.
